Job description
Job Description

  • Execute and perform testing as per methods, following the company’s Standard Operating Procedures, Deviations and Change Control programs and cGMP guidelines.
  • Ensure that work order documentation is complete in every aspect and all results are entered into the electronic Laboratory Information System or the Client’s Certificate of Analysis before submission to the QA reviewer.
  • Prioritize, schedule and plan daily work in order to maintain efficient workflow to assure completion of schedule and due dates.
  • In case of testing failure, immediately report to the Department Manager before proceeding any further with the test. Assist in the failure investigations as instructed. Do not discard any solutions or glassware that was used during testing.
  • Inform the Department Manager and/or Group Leader, as far in advance as possible, if the assigned work order cannot be satisfactorily completed within established scheduled time and quality of work expectations.
  • Perform additional assigned lab duties and periodically update Department Manager and/or Group Leader on the status.
  • Ensure that equipment is maintained in good order, perform calibrations and qualifications as required, volumetric/test solutions and mobile phase preparations are checked.
  • Record findings in standardized format, keeping all records and analyst notebook in good order.
  • Conduct calibration and preventive maintenance of instruments/testing apparatus (e.g., HPLC, GC, Dissolution, Thermometer, Oven, etc.) for compliance and accurate testing results.

Qualifications

  • Education: B.Sc. Chemistry or relevant field.
  • Experience: 1-3 years with demonstrated ability to complete more complex role/duties
  • Experience testing with the following instrumentation: HPLC, GC, Dissolution, Thermometer, Oven
  • Hand/Eye coordination, ability to stand out, think outside the box.
  • Able to read, understand and follow work instructions in a safe, accurate and timely manner.
  • Proficient in using various types of computer software (Word, Excel. PowerPoint & Outlook).
  • Proven ability to manage and coordinate multiple projects in a fast-paced, highly professional environment.
  • Demonstrates excellent verbal and written communication skills.
  • Ability to work well with others & independently.
  • Works well under pressure.
  • Extended hours and shift work may be required from time to time.
